Boost Your Crochet Skills Fast
By mastering a few essential techniques, you can rapidly elevate your crochet skills and open up a world of creative possibilities. To boost your skills fast, focus on quick techniques that streamline your workflow.
Efficient crafting begins with a solid foundation in basic stitches, so practice your single crochet, double crochet, and slip stitch until they become second nature.
Next, experiment with advanced techniques like working in the round, creating texture with stitch variations, and mastering the art of seaming. With these skills under your belt, you'll be able to tackle complex projects with confidence and ease.

Can I Use Different Hook Sizes for This Project?
While hook size flexibility is appealing, noting that utilizing different hook sizes can change the fabric's density is crucial, impacting the overall texture and appearance of your project, particularly when working with different yarns and color variations.
What Is the Ideal Length for the Dowel?
When selecting a dowel size, consider the desired stability and weight capacity of your organizer. A 1/2 inch dowel provides ideal support, while longer dowels offer increased design versatility and organizational options.

How Do I Prevent My Organizer From Sagging?
To prevent sagging, make sure your organizer's reinforcement is sturdy, and fabric choice is suitable for the intended weight. Consider a strong hanging mechanism, such as a wooden dowel or metal rod, and explore customization options for best support and stability.
